January 11, 20249:39 am
Author: Claire Parker, Emily Rauhala
South Africa argues Israel is violating international law by committing and failing to prevent genocide with the intention “to destroy Palestinians in Gaza.”
January 11, 20249:39 am
Author: Claire Parker, Emily Rauhala